Metro Learning Classroom Sites
The College of Lifelong Learning has become known as “the unit that takes the University to the people" throughout the State of Mississippi, elsewhere in the United States, and worldwide. Metro Learning Classroom Sites are one approach to accomplishing the mission of the College of Lifelong Learning. They are established in communities where masses of people desire to access higher education and training.

Learn Close to Home or Wherever You Want
Metro Learning Classroom Sites are designed to meet the needs of adult learners with emphasis on relevance, convenience, and accessibility. By taking classes close to home, during evenings and on weekends, busy adults can find the time they need to maintain their current lifestyle and earn a degree. The sites provide a wide range of services and information related to admissions, financial aid, degree completion, graduate studies, continuing education courses, and printed materials on academic programs, services, and cultural events. By taking classes online, adults can take classes at home, while traveling, or at work – wherever they want.

Metro Learning Classroom Sites Activities
Metro Learning Classroom Sites offer a wide variety of academic and non-academic credit activities through the School of General and Continuing Studies, Center for Adult and Continuing Education, and the Continuing Education Learning Center. Academic courses for credit are currently being offered in: interdisciplinary degree studies, education, criminal justice, industrial technology, social work, teacher certification, English as a Second Language (ESL), and many others; but what you learn is not limited to these areas. Workshop, certificate, and institute formats allow you to pursue studies in any interest area upon request.
